Canadian Radio "Virtual Road Trip"
With the Canadian Music Week conference kicking off this week, Radio-Info executive editor of music and programming Sean Ross takes a “virtual road trip” of Canadian CHR coast to coast, listening to as many major-market CHR and Adult CHRs as possible. It starts today with the first leg—Newfoundland to Ottawa.
